Where you'll be working
Anaesthesia training at the John Hunter Hospital campus offers a rare opportunity to be involved in anaesthesia across the lifespan at a single location. We provide exposure to adult, paediatric, trauma, cardiothoracic, neuro (including interventional radiology), complex head and neck, major vascular, and obstetric anaesthesia.

In addition, fellows have opportunities to participate in our active and highly regarded regional anaesthesia and perioperative services and, for successful applicants, the Hunter Retrieval Service, which provides primary and secondary retrieval services across the district.

Interested trainees may apply to work 0.5 FTE in the Hunter New England Simulation Centre (HNESC), one of the busiest and longest-running simulation centres in Australia. The centre provides simulation-based education for practising clinicians across all disciplines and supports patient safety and systems improvement initiatives across the health district.

These fellowship positions are suited to trainees with interests in simulation-based education, Human Factors, healthcare quality and safety, and systems improvement. Established in 2017, our Human Factors (Quality & Safety) Fellowship was the first of its kind in Australia and remains a unique opportunity to combine anaesthesia, simulation, and systems-focused healthcare improvement within a major tertiary referral network.

What you'll be doing 

The purpose of this Simulation/Anaesthesia position is twofold:

  • To provide an opportunity for trainees (0.53 FTE) to develop sub-specialty expertise in education, training, and, for interested trainees, research using simulation-based methodologies.  This position will suit trainees with an interest in application of human factors to solve challenges in healthcare as well as those with an interest in education.  The goal is to produce a Medical Specialist who is able to independently manage key components of simulation-based education and training.

  • To provide an outstanding opportunity (0.47 FTE) to develop and consolidate clinical skills by contributing to the delivery of high-quality anaesthesia services for the patients of the Hunter New England district.  Together these opportunities will enable a trainee to wok towards obtaining Fellowship of the Australian and New Zealand College of Anaesthetists.
